## Formula sandbox tuning

User-supplied formulas in Gridmoor execute inside a restricted interpreter with hard ceilings on time, memory, and call depth. Reviewers should confirm any change to these ceilings is justified in the PR description, since raising them widens the abuse surface. Defaults were chosen from production traces. The current limits are as follows.

limits module of tafog-fawip:
WEIGHTS = {
    "julix": 57,
    "lamys": 992,
    "kasvan": 209,
    "quenok": 750,
    "alddor": 259,
    "oliath": 1009,
    "wenix": 815,
}

Vendor note — thumbnail queue. Pixelwright Ltd. operates the hosted thumbnail generation queue for the Lanternbox asset pipeline. Access is scoped to signed upload tokens; no raw originals leave our storage tier. Their SOC attestation expires next quarter and renewal is in progress. For audit artifacts or questions on token scoping, use the address below.

escalation mailbox, bafog-fafog: ulador@paliqlabs.internal

Subject: Quickstore 4.2 — bloom filter now fronts the KV layer

Plugin authors: starting with this release, Quickstore places a bloom filter ahead of the key-value store. Negative lookups return faster; false positives fall through safely. No API changes are required on your side. Verify your plugin against the staging build referenced below.

session token of fahif-tadup = htk3_9c7

Handover for the Fernside clinic reminder job — bringing this to the weekly sync. The job scans tomorrow's appointments each evening and queues SMS and voice reminders. Known quirk: it double-sends if the scheduler restarts mid-run, so check the dedupe table before replaying anything. I bumped the batch size last week and latency looks fine. For whoever picks this up, the reminder worker currently runs with the configuration values listed below.

deployment values, fahap-hahaf:
[casdor]
port = 9200
region = south-2
host = casdor.qirvanworks.corp
timeout_ms = 3000
retries = 4

Subject: DR Drill — Queryline N+1 Fix Verification

Dear plugin authors: during next week's disaster-recovery drill, the Queryline gateway will run the batched resolver patch that eliminates the N+1 query pattern. Please verify your plugins tolerate batched responses. If the drill forces a vault reset, use the passphrase below to restore access.

vault phrase of kafog-kahif = holdor-rusir-praox